For starters, bad breath can be cause by eating extremely strong-smelling foods (such as garlic). A good way to begin addressing your bad breath is eliminating these foods from your diet for a few days to see if your bad breath subsides. If not, the cause of your problem is likely bacteria (which is easily diminished with preventive dentistry). Unfortunately, the bacteria in your mouth often give off a very unpleasant odor – the more bacteria you have, the worse your breath
